Disney’s Contemporary Resort Review
What Works, What Doesn’t, and Who Should Stay Here
Disney’s Contemporary Resort is one of the most recognizable hotels in Walt Disney World.
The monorail runs directly through the building, it’s within walking distance of Magic Kingdom, and it’s one of the original Disney World resorts that opened in 1971.
But when you book the Contemporary, you’re actually choosing between three very different experiences:
• The Main Tower
• The Garden Wing
• Bay Lake Tower villas

The Three Areas of the Contemporary Resort
Main Tower
The Main Tower is the iconic A-frame building most people picture when they think about the Contemporary.
This is where you'll find:
• the monorail station
• California Grill
• Chef Mickey’s
• Contempo Cafe
• the main pool area
Rooms here are the closest to everything, but they also come with the most activity and noise.
The biggest perk?
Theme park view rooms that overlook Magic Kingdom and the fireworks.
Garden Wing
The Garden Wing is often the most misunderstood option at the resort.
These rooms are located in a separate building connected by a short outdoor walk.
Pros
• Lower price than the Main Tower
• Quieter environment
• Same room layout as tower rooms
Cons
• Slightly longer walk to dining and monorail
For many families, this is actually the smartest way to stay at the Contemporary.
Bay Lake Tower
Bay Lake Tower is the Disney Vacation Club section of the resort.
This building offers:
• studios
• one-bedroom villas
• multi-bedroom villas
These rooms include kitchenettes or full kitchens and are great for longer stays or multi-generational trips.
Dining at Disney’s Contemporary Resort
Some of the most popular restaurants at Walt Disney World are located here.
California Grill
Signature dining with incredible views of Magic Kingdom.
Steakhouse 71
One of the best casual dining values at Disney.
Chef Mickey’s
Classic character dining with Mickey and friends.
Contempo Cafe
Quick service option for sandwiches, flatbreads and pastries.
The Biggest Advantage: Location
The main reason people stay here is simple.
You can walk to Magic Kingdom.
The resort also has:
• Monorail access to Magic Kingdom
• Monorail transfer to EPCOT
• Bus transportation to other parks
That convenience alone is enough to make this resort the best choice for some travelers.
Who Should Stay Here
The Contemporary works best for:
• Magic Kingdom focused trips
• Families with small kids and strollers
• Travelers who want maximum convenience
• Multi-generational families staying in Bay Lake Tower
Who Should Skip It
This might not be the right resort if you want:
• heavy Disney theming
• a quiet resort environment
• a heavily themed pool area
In those cases, resorts like Polynesian Village Resort or Wilderness Lodge may be a better fit.
